Mia Raya, 37, of Clinton, was arrested Dec. 6 on charges of child abuse, affixing an unauthorized license plate on a vehicle with intent to conceal or misrepresent identity of the vehicle, attempting to elude a police officer after receiving signal to stop when endangering another person, resisting arrest by force or violence, driving a vehicle with a suspended license, reckless driving, obstructing an officer, and operating a vehicle without a proper license plate for the current year.

ALTOONA, Pa. (AP) — The man charged with murder in the killing of the CEO of UnitedHealthcare made it clear he wasn’t going to make things easy for authorities, shouting unintelligibly and writhing in the grip of sheriff’s deputies as he was led into court and then objecting to being taken to New York to face trial.
